Services for Syble Jean James, of Wesson, were Monday, Oct. 30,at Sardis Baptist Church, with burial in Sardis Cemetery. StringerFuneral Home was in charge of arrangements.

Mrs. James, 74, died Oct. 27, 2006, at her residence. She was anative of Jefferson Davis County.

She was retired from Bernsteins and Sons after many years ofservice. She was a member of Sardis Baptist church.

Preceding her in death were her husband, Percy James; her son,Cecil James; her grandson, Robert Elkins Jr.; and granddaughter,Lynette Chamberlain.

Survivors are her daughters, Diane Brown and Sherry Brown, bothof Wesson, Virginia Smith, of Brookhaven, and Sallie Norman, ofHattiesburg; her sisters, Willie Mae Hughes, of Strong Hope, andMildred Leon, of Ft. Worth, Texas; and her 17 grandchildren and 33great-grandchildren.
